Annual short term debt:
$177.80M+$31.10M(+21.20%)Summary
- As of today (May 29, 2025), MRVL annual short term debt is $177.80 million, with the most recent change of +$31.10 million (+21.20%) on January 1, 2025.
- During the last 3 years, MRVL annual short term debt has risen by +$76.40 million (+75.35%).
- MRVL annual short term debt is now -71.70% below its all-time high of $628.20 million, reached on January 28, 2023.

Short term debt Formula
Short-Term Debt = Current Portion of Long-Term Debt + Short-Term Loans + Commercial Paper + Other Short-Term Borrowings
